Patents by Inventor Robert Monaghan
Robert Monaghan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11961248Abstract: An encoder is disclosed that uses hyperspectral data to produce a unified three-dimensional (“3D”) scan that incorporates depth for various points, surfaces, and features within a scene. The encoder may scan a particular point of the scene using frequencies from different electromagnetic spectrum bands, may determine spectral properties of the particular point based on returns measured across a first set of bands, may measure a distance of the particular point using frequencies of another band that does not interfere with the spectral properties at each of the first set of bands, and may encode the spectral properties and the distance of the particular point in a single hyperspectral dataset. The spectral signature encoded within the dataset may be used to classify the particular point or generate a point cloud or other visualization that accurately represents the spectral properties and distances of the scanned points.Type: GrantFiled: May 30, 2023Date of Patent: April 16, 2024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Publication number: 20240112306Abstract: Disclosed is a system and associated methods for generating a composite image from scans or images that are aligned using invisible fiducials. The invisible fiducial is a transparent substance or a projected specific wavelength that is applied to and changes reflectivity of a surface at the specific wavelength without interfering with a capture of positions or visible color characteristics across the surface. The system performs first and second capture of a scene with the surface, and detects a position of the invisible fiducial in each capture based on values measured across the specific wavelength that satisfy a threshold associated with the invisible fiducial. The system aligns the first capture with the second capture based on the detected positions of the invisible fiducial, and generates a composite image by merging or combining the positions or visible color characteristics from the aligned captures.Type: ApplicationFiled: August 30, 2023Publication date: April 4, 2024Applicant: Illuscio, Inc.Inventors: Mark Weingartner, Robert Monaghan
-
Patent number: 11936839Abstract: Disclosed are systems and methods for the out-of-order predictive streaming of elements from a three-dimensional (“3D”) image file so that a recipient device is able to produce a first visualization of at least a first streamed element from a particular perspective, similar to the instant transfer of two-dimensional (“2D”) images, while the additional elements and perspectives of the 3D image are streamed. The sending device prioritizes the 3D image elements based on a predicted viewing order, streams a particular element from a particular perspective with a priority that is greater than a priority associated with other elements and other perspectives, determines a next element to stream after the particular element based on the next element being positioned adjacent to the particular element and having a priority that is greater than adjacent elements, and streams the next element to the recipient device.Type: GrantFiled: August 7, 2023Date of Patent: March 19, 2024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Publication number: 20240070887Abstract: An encoder is disclosed that uses hyperspectral data to produce a unified three-dimensional (“3D”) scan that incorporates depth for various points, surfaces, and features within a scene. The encoder may scan a particular point of the scene using frequencies from different electromagnetic spectrum bands, may determine spectral properties of the particular point based on returns measured across a first set of bands, may measure a distance of the particular point using frequencies of another band that does not interfere with the spectral properties at each of the first set of bands, and may encode the spectral properties and the distance of the particular point in a single hyperspectral dataset. The spectral signature encoded within the dataset may be used to classify the particular point or generate a point cloud or other visualization that accurately represents the spectral properties and distances of the scanned points.Type: ApplicationFiled: May 30, 2023Publication date: February 29, 2024Applicant: Illuscio, Inc.Inventor: Robert Monaghan
-
Patent number: 11893684Abstract: Disclosed is an encoding and decoding system and associated methods for producing a compressed waveform that encodes data points of a point cloud in a format and size that may be transmitted over a data network, decompressed, decoded, and rendered on a remote device without the buffering or lag associated with transmitting and rendering an uncompressed point cloud. The encoder receives a request from a remote device to access the point cloud, encodes a set of data points from the point cloud as one or more signals derived from values defined for the positional and non-positional elements of each data point from the set of data points, generates one or more compressed waveforms from compressing the one or more signals and transmits the one or more compressed waveforms to the remote device in response to the request for decompression, decoding, and image rendering.Type: GrantFiled: August 3, 2023Date of Patent: February 6, 2024Assignee: Illuscio, Inc.Inventors: Robert Monaghan, Fatemeh Jamalidinan, Mark Weingartner, Dwayne Elahie, Kevin Edward Dean
-
Patent number: 11869153Abstract: Provided is a system for structured and controlled movement and viewing within a point cloud. The system may generate or obtain a plurality of data points and one or more waypoints for the point cloud, present a first subset of the plurality of data points in a field-of-view of a camera at an initial position and an initial orientation of a first waypoint, change the camera field-of-view from at least one of (i) the initial position to a modified position within a volume of positions defined by orientation controls of the first waypoint or (ii) the initial orientation to a modified orientation within a range of orientations defined by the orientation controls of the first waypoint, and may present a second subset of the plurality of data points in the camera field-of-view at one or more of the modified position and the modified orientation.Type: GrantFiled: August 20, 2020Date of Patent: January 9, 2024Assignee: Illuscio, Inc.Inventors: Joseph Bogacz, Robert Monaghan
-
Patent number: 11854154Abstract: Disclosed is a three-dimensional (“3D”) scanning system that synchronizes the scanning of a scene with the viewing of the scan results relative to a live view of the scene. The system includes a first device that scans a first set of surfaces that are exposed to the first device from a first position. The system further includes a second device that receives the scan data as it is generated for each scanned surface of the first set of surfaces. The second device augments a visualization of a second set of surfaces, within a field-of-view of the second device from a second position, with the scan data that is generated for a subset of scanned surfaces from the first position corresponding to one or more surfaces of the second set of surfaces visualized from the second position.Type: GrantFiled: August 3, 2023Date of Patent: December 26, 2023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Patent number: 11756178Abstract: Disclosed is a system and associated methods for generating a composite image from scans or images that are aligned using invisible fiducials. The invisible fiducial is a transparent substance or a projected specific wavelength that is applied to and changes reflectivity of a surface at the specific wavelength without interfering with a capture of positions or visible color characteristics across the surface. The system performs first and second capture of a scene with the surface, and detects a position of the invisible fiducial in each capture based on values measured across the specific wavelength that satisfy a threshold associated with the invisible fiducial. The system aligns the first capture with the second capture based on the detected positions of the invisible fiducial, and generates a composite image by merging or combining the positions or visible color characteristics from the aligned captures.Type: GrantFiled: September 30, 2022Date of Patent: September 12, 2023Assignee: Illuscio, Inc.Inventors: Mark Weingartner, Robert Monaghan
-
Patent number: 11758104Abstract: Disclosed are systems and methods for the out-of-order predictive streaming of elements from a three-dimensional (“3D”) image file so that a recipient device is able to produce a first visualization of at least a first streamed element from a particular perspective, similar to the instant transfer of two-dimensional (“2D”) images, while the additional elements and perspectives of the 3D image are streamed. The sending device prioritizes the 3D image elements based on a predicted viewing order, streams a particular element from a particular perspective with a priority that is greater than a priority associated with other elements and other perspectives, determines a next element to stream after the particular element based on the next element being positioned adjacent to the particular element and having a priority that is greater than adjacent elements, and streams the next element to the recipient device.Type: GrantFiled: October 18, 2022Date of Patent: September 12, 2023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Patent number: 11748945Abstract: Disclosed is an encoding and decoding system and associated methods for producing a compressed waveform that encodes data points of a point cloud in a format and size that may be transmitted over a data network, decompressed, decoded, and rendered on a remote device without the buffering or lag associated with transmitting and rendering an uncompressed point cloud. The encoder receives a request from a remote device to access the point cloud, encodes a set of data points from the point cloud as one or more signals derived from values defined for the positional and non-positional elements of each data point from the set of data points, generates one or more compressed waveforms from compressing the one or more signals and transmits the one or more compressed waveforms to the remote device in response to the request for decompression, decoding, and image rendering.Type: GrantFiled: February 14, 2023Date of Patent: September 5, 2023Assignee: Illuscio, Inc.Inventors: Robert Monaghan, Fatemeh Jamalidinan, Mark Weingartner, Dwayne Elahie, Kevin Edward Dean
-
Patent number: 11727655Abstract: Disclosed is a three-dimensional (“3D”) scanning system that synchronizes the scanning of a scene with the viewing of the scan results relative to a live view of the scene. The system includes a first device that scans a first set of surfaces that are exposed to the first device from a first position. The system further includes a second device that receives the scan data as it is generated for each scanned surface of the first set of surfaces. The second device augments a visualization of a second set of surfaces, within a field-of-view of the second device from a second position, with the scan data that is generated for a subset of scanned surfaces from the first position corresponding to one or more surfaces of the second set of surfaces visualized from the second position.Type: GrantFiled: October 20, 2022Date of Patent: August 15, 2023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Patent number: 11721034Abstract: Disclosed is a system and associated methods for generating and rendering a polyhedral point cloud that represents a scene with multi-faceted primitives. Each multi-faceted primitive stores multiple sets of values that represent different non-positional characteristics that are associated with a particular point in the scene from different angles. For instance, the system generates a multi-faceted primitive for a particular point of the scene that is captured in first capture from a first position and a second capture from a different second position.Type: GrantFiled: February 14, 2023Date of Patent: August 8, 2023Assignee: Illuscio, Inc.Inventors: Robert Monaghan, Mark Weingartner
-
Patent number: 11704769Abstract: Disclosed are systems and associated methods for generating a regularized image from non-uniformly distributed image data based on a curve derived from the image data. The curve is used to reduce the non-uniformity in the image data without losing detail or changing the overall image. Regularizing the image includes obtaining a tree-based representation of the non-uniformly distributed image data, generating a regularization curve that models a particular distribution of the image data, and applying the regularization curve to the tree-based representation in order to select the nodes of the tree-based representation for the decimated image data to render in place of the original image data and the original image data to preserve and render as part of the regularized image. Specifically, the system render the original image data associated with leaf nodes and the decimated image data associated with parent nodes that intersect or are within the regularization curve.Type: GrantFiled: January 25, 2023Date of Patent: July 18, 2023Assignee: Illuscio, Inc.Inventors: Mark Weingartner, Robert Monaghan
-
Patent number: 11704838Abstract: An encoder may perform a dynamic encoding that adapts the encoding of hyperspectral data according to the number of bands of the electromagnetic spectrum that are captured by different imaging devices, the amount of data that is contained in each band, and/or encoding criteria that are specified by a user or that are automatically generated by the encoder for an optimal encoding of the hyperspectral data. The encoder may receive hyperspectral data for different electromagnetic spectrum bands. The encoder may determine an encoding resolution based on one or more of a number of bands and a maximum resolution within the received bands. The encoder may configure a block size for a file format that is used to store an encoding of the hyperspectral data based on the encoding resolution, and may encode the hyperspectral data contained within each band to at least one block of the block size.Type: GrantFiled: December 29, 2022Date of Patent: July 18, 2023Assignee: Illuscio, Inc.Inventors: Dwayne Elahie, Robert Monaghan
-
Patent number: 11694398Abstract: Disclosed is a system that receives a point cloud, and that generates a Bounding Volume Hierarchy (“BVH”) based on the point cloud data points. The BVH includes leaf nodes and parent nodes at one or more levels above the leaf nodes. The leaf nodes correspond to the point cloud data points. The system may receive input for adjusting a first set of elements of data points that are identified based on values specified for a second set of elements, and may locate those data points by traversing the BVH to arrive at a particular parent node that encompasses the values specified for the second set of elements. The system may then modify, based on the input, the first set of elements of a set of data points that correspond to a set of leaf nodes from the BVH that are directly or indirectly linked to the particular parent node.Type: GrantFiled: September 8, 2022Date of Patent: July 4, 2023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Patent number: 11688087Abstract: An encoder is disclosed that uses hyperspectral data to produce a unified three-dimensional (“3D”) scan that incorporates depth for various points, surfaces, and features within a scene. The encoder may scan a particular point of the scene using frequencies from different electromagnetic spectrum bands, may determine spectral properties of the particular point based on returns measured across a first set of bands, may measure a distance of the particular point using frequencies of another band that does not interfere with the spectral properties at each of the first set of bands, and may encode the spectral properties and the distance of the particular point in a single hyperspectral dataset. The spectral signature encoded within the dataset may be used to classify the particular point or generate a point cloud or other visualization that accurately represents the spectral properties and distances of the scanned points.Type: GrantFiled: August 26, 2022Date of Patent: June 27, 2023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Patent number: 11645824Abstract: Disclosed are systems and methods for defining, bonding, and editing point cloud data points with primitives. In particular, a system may receive a point cloud with data points that are defined by positional and non-positional elements. The system may associate primitives to each data point based on a material or a property associated with the surface, feature, or article at a position in an imaged three-dimensional (“3D”) environment that corresponds to a particular position of the data point in the point cloud. The system may receive input for a first adjustment to at least one of the data point elements, and may edit point cloud by defining a second adjustment that modifies the first adjustment according to a rule of a particular primitive, and by applying the second adjustment to the at least one element of a first set of data points that are associated with the particular primitive.Type: GrantFiled: September 27, 2022Date of Patent: May 9, 2023Assignee: Illuscio, Inc.Inventors: Robert Monaghan, Tim Sung
-
Patent number: 11593959Abstract: Disclosed is a system and associated methods for generating and rendering a polyhedral point cloud that represents a scene with multi-faceted primitives. Each multi-faceted primitive stores multiple sets of values that represent different non-positional characteristics that are associated with a particular point in the scene from different angles. For instance, the system generates a multi-faceted primitive for a particular point of the scene that is captured in first capture from a first position and a second capture from a different second position.Type: GrantFiled: September 30, 2022Date of Patent: February 28, 2023Assignee: Illuscio, Inc.Inventors: Robert Monaghan, Mark Weingartner
-
Patent number: 11593921Abstract: Disclosed is a system to add photorealistic detail and motion to an image based on a first material property associated with a first set of data points of an incomplete first object, and a second material property associated with a second set of data points of an incomplete second object in the image. The system may generate first artificial data points amongst the first set of data points that completes a first arrangement defined for the first material property, and may generate second artificial data points amongst the second set of data points that completes a second arrangement defined for the second material property. The system may then output an enhanced image of the completed first object based on first set of data points and the first artificial data points, and of the completed second object based on the second set of data points and the second artificial data points.Type: GrantFiled: March 22, 2022Date of Patent: February 28, 2023Assignee: Illuscio, Inc.Inventor: Robert Monaghan
-
Patent number: 11562464Abstract: An image postprocessor enhances the quality and detail of a rendered image by applying a photosite demosaicing technique directly to the pixels stored in the viewport of the rendered image. The image postprocessor detects a first subset of the viewport pixels having color values that deviate by more than a threshold amount from color values of a neighboring second subset of the viewport pixels. The image postprocessor maps the viewport pixels to a set of emulated photosites based on a position of each pixel in the viewport, and demosaics and/or interpolates the color values associated with a subset of the emulated photosites in order to generate new pixels for the gap. The image postprocessor replaces the first subset of pixels in the viewport with the new pixels, and presents a second visualization based on the modified pixels of the viewport.Type: GrantFiled: September 29, 2022Date of Patent: January 24, 2023Assignee: Illuscio, Inc.Inventors: Robert Monaghan, Kevan Spencer Barsky